Regula (Riga, Latvia; founded 1992) - forensic-grade identity document verification + biometrics; SDKs and hardware for KYC/onboarding. Software vendor.

Authologic (Warsaw, Poland; Y Combinator 2021) - orchestration layer for identity verification: one API aggregating local KYC/AML methods - government eIDs, bank-based verification (AIS) and video/biometrics - across markets. USD 8.2m Series A led by OpenOcean (Oct 2024). Registered AISP (KNF).

InfoCert (Rome, Italy) - Tinexta Infocert, one of Europe's largest eIDAS Qualified Trust Service Providers (QTSP), active in 20+ countries: qualified e-signatures and seals, timestamping, identity wallets and digital archiving. On the EU Trusted List (AgID); owns 51% of Camerfirma (ES) plus the LuxTrust JV (LU). Part of the listed Tinexta Group (IT).
